The Pestana Palace Hotel, situated in Alto de Santo, is the perfect place to take up residence when staying in Lisbon for 24 hours.

Born in Johannesburg in 1952 and educated at the University of the Witswatersrand, Dionísio Fernandes Pestana left South Africa for Portugal in 1976, a year after the 25th of April revolution in that country. Together with his father, Manuel, they have since created a kingdom of hotels that spreads over three continents. The Pestana Palace Hotel in Lisbon is just one of them.
